Rwanda - Import of Woven Fabrics Obtained from High Tenacity Nylon Yarn
Since 2014, Rwanda Import of Woven Fabrics Obtained from High Tenacity Nylon Yarn grew 33.5%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 131 comparing other countries in Import of Woven Fabrics Obtained from High Tenacity Nylon Yarn with $68,101. Rwanda is overtaken by Barbados, which was ranked number 130 with $69,430.8 and is followed by Botswana with $64,943.8. Viet Nam topped the ranking with $168,353,320.46 in 2019, an increase of 3.6% versus 2018. Algeria, Panama and Indonesia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Guyana recorded the best 5 years average growth at +260.8% per year, while Kyrgyzstan was the worst growing country at -72.8% per year.
